Tropicana Animal Hospital boasts a long-standing reputation in Las Vegas for providing a wide array of veterinary services. As part of The Nave Veterinary Group, this facility is committed to upholding high standards of practice, evident in its accreditation by the American Animal Hospital Association (AAHA). This accreditation signifies a voluntary commitment to exceeding stringent quality standards in patient care, facility management, and staff training. The hospital aims to foster a strong partnership with pet owners, emphasizing compassionate, expert, and affordable veterinary services to nurture the human-animal bond. Tropicana Animal Hospital, a full-service animal hospital, offers a comprehensive range of veterinary services designed to address virtually every aspect of pet health for dogs and cats. Their commitment, as an AAHA-accredited facility, is to provide expert and compassionate care, from a pet's first visit through their senior years. The breadth of services available ensures that most of a pet's healthcare needs can be met conveniently under one roof. These services typically include:
- Wellness and Preventative Care: Including routine examinations, personalized vaccination protocols, and comprehensive preventative health programs designed to keep pets healthy and proactively avert diseases.
- Comprehensive Surgical Services: Performing a wide range of surgical procedures, from common routine operations like spaying and neutering to more intricate soft tissue surgeries.
- Advanced Dental Care: Offering complete dental services, including professional dental cleanings, extractions, and addressing various oral health issues crucial for a pet's overall well-being. They utilize dental radiology for thorough assessments.
- Diagnostic Imaging: Employing cutting-edge technology such as digital radiography (X-rays) and ultrasound for accurate and timely diagnoses. Some facilities within The Nave Veterinary Group may also offer endoscopic procedures.
- In-House Laboratory: Equipped with an in-house laboratory for rapid and efficient diagnostic testing, including blood work, urinalysis, and fecal analysis, enabling quick treatment decisions.
- Emergency and Urgent Care: The hospital is equipped to handle daytime emergencies and critical cases, providing immediate attention and stabilization for pets in urgent need. They are available for after-hour emergencies as well.
- Senior Pet Wellness Care: Specialized programs and monitoring tailored for older pets, focusing on managing age-related conditions and enhancing their quality of life.
- Pet Boarding and Bathing: Providing comprehensive boarding facilities, often with "luxury pet hotel" options, and bathing services for convenience when pet owners travel or require grooming assistance.
- Pharmacy Services: An on-site pharmacy for convenient and immediate access to prescribed medications and a variety of veterinary-grade products.
- Nutritional Counseling: Offering expert guidance on appropriate diets for pets of all ages, breeds, and specific health conditions, aiding in optimal weight management and overall vitality.
- Client Education: Dedicated to providing valuable information and educational resources to empower pet owners to make informed and proactive decisions about their animal's care, based on their individual situation and lifestyle.
- End-of-Life Care: Providing compassionate support and options for end-of-life decisions, including euthanasia, with a focus on comfort and dignity.

Sep 22, 2020 · Rose HortonWe have been going here for years with 3 pets. I have since lost 2 this past year. Every Dr. and Tech I have interacted with has been wonderful. This particular apt was just to drop off my last baby for teeth cleaning. Everything went well from drop off to pick up. They are very busy so you will have to wait. That can be annoying, so pack your patience.

Jul 10, 2021 · Sharon OssumIf you actually care about your pets, DO NOT GO HERE!!!! I can’t believe how rude the front desk is (except for Natalie, who was the only person with actual customer service, thank you Natalie!) and how bad everyone is with communication!!!I brought my dog in for vomiting and diarrhea, Dr.Ledezma said she’d like to start with x-rays and a parvo test. They took my dog back and said they were going to do x-rays, when a different girl brought my dog back she said “so we’re running that bloodwork now, should take 10-15 minutes” I NEVER CONSENTED TO BLOODWORK!!! When I asked why this was done she said “well doctor recommends it and your insurance covers it, if you want, we can hold off on running it” WHY WOULD I HOLD OFF WHEN YOU ALREADY PULLED THE BLOOD FROM MY DOG?!?!?!?!!!!!!! I agreed to let my dog stay for the day for fluids and doctor said she would be in when I picked up. Spoiler alert, she was not!The girl who brought my dog out knew nothing about my dog, told me to feed her chicken and rice even though she’s allergic and didn’t even know the gender of my dog! Then assured me that everything was submitted to my insurance. Another spoiler alert, nothing was submitted!So after all that, i over paid them because they said my insurance was being weird (which is untrue). I called to speak with the manager and explained all of this to her and asked her to submit my invoice to my insurance and I would need a refund once we heard back. That was Monday, 1/23. It is now Friday. The manager is ducking my calls and the reception staff is being extremely rude every time I call. This place is a JOKE! They have taken over $200 extra from me (and got paid by our insurance) and now not calling me back! I am so shocked with the incompetence that is shown here. Truly embarrassing.
